The stellar associations of the Small Magellanic Cloud

Abstract

The stellar associations of the SMC are less well defined than those of the LMC. A catalog is presented of 70 probable examples, of which 16 objects are of a more questionable nature. The associations have almost exactly the same mean size as those in the LMC but are poorer in the number of bright members. There are several problems in establishing the identity and the true properties of such objects in extragalactic sources.
